Occupation, Colonial and Post War Philately
Colonial, post-war, and occupation issues form the core of this wide-ranging international auction, which brings together rare stamps, banknotes, coins, and porcelain from major world empires and historically significant regions. Collectors will find notable material from the British Empire, French colonial holdings, Portuguese territories, German occupation areas, and Japanese military administrations ? including elusive overprints, provisional issues, and desirable examples of classic postal history.
A particularly strong segment of the sale focuses on China, featuring philately, banknotes, coinage, and porcelain from the Qing Dynasty through the Republican era, along with regional issues and specialized overprints. Additional Asian material includes Japanese occupation issues and wartime currencies, together with items from India and Southeast Asia.
The auction also presents an appealing complement of North American material, with stamps and numismatics from the United States, Canada, and Mexico, representing both early domestic productions and historically significant regional varieties.
Uniting these varied sections is an emphasis on scarcity, authenticity, and historical relevance. This sale will appeal to collectors of worldwide stamps, colonial currency, Asian collectibles, distinctive overprints, and international numismatics ? a catalogue that spans centuries of global postal and monetary history.
